Berber/Muslim Conquest of the Iberian Peninsula (9 ene 711 año – 1 ene 756 año)

Descripción:

The Muslim Conquest of the Iberian Peninsula began in spring 711, where Musa ibn Nusayr, the Arab governor of the northwest Africa, conquered Spain with the help of commander Tariq ibn Ziyad. 

Musa was then recalled back to Damascus by the Umayyad caliph, leaving the conquered lands with his son, Abd al-Aziz, who in three years, extended his control over most of the Iberian Peninsula, which came to be known as al-Andalus. 

However, power switched from Umayyad to the Abbasid caliphate, and the first caliph, Abu'l- Abbas al-Saffah, slaughtered all members of the Umayyad caliphate, except for one, the young prince Abd al-Rahman.

He then escaped to northwest Africa, and then eventually to Spain, where, in 756, he established himself in Córdoba, which was the beginning of the Umayyad dynasy in Spain.
